    Abstract: A secondary battery charging system, mounted on a vehicle having an internal combustion engine, has a secondary battery, a fuel cell, a fuel storage unit, and a fuel supply controller. In order to start the engine of the vehicle, the engine requires the electric power from the secondary battery. The fuel storage unit stores a fuel to be supplied to the fuel cell. When a given condition is satisfied, the fuel supply controller instructs the fuel storage unit to supply the fuel to the fuel cell in order to start the operation of the engine of the vehicle. The fuel cell thereby starts the generation of the electric power by performing electric chemical reaction and supplies the generated electric power to the secondary battery. The secondary battery supplies the electric power to the engine of the vehicle. The engine initiates its operation.

    Abstract: There is provided an ink jet recording head which can efficiently prevent ink from corroding an insulating film layer. A positive electrode is disposed on an upper surface of the insulating film layer and a negative electrode is disposed on a lower surface of the insulating film layer, which is referred to as a turnover structure. There is no electrode between any two adjacent heater resistor portions. As a result, high-density disposition of the heater resistor portions can be carried out. The heater resistor portions are thermally oxidized, so that surfaces thereof are changed into tantalum insulating films (surface oxidation films), which serve as ink protection layers. A second insulating film layer is totally covered by the heater resistor portions and the partition walls and is not exposed. Thus, ink does not contact the second insulating film layer, and the second insulating film layer is not corroded by ink.

    Abstract: A liquid fuel vaporizer includes a combustion chamber in which heat is generated by burning fuel therein, an vaporization chamber in which liquid fuel is vaporized by the heat transferred from the combustion chamber to the vaporization chamber. Both chambers are integrally built in a housing, and liquid fuel is supplied from a single injector to both chambers. Liquid fuel consisting of small particles is supplied to the combustion chamber to improve combustion efficiency. Vaporized fuel in the vaporization chamber is prevented from being ignited and burnt therein by various manners, such as intercepting combustion flame, controlling an air/fuel ratio in a range out of a combustible range, or keeping vaporized fuel temperature at a level lower than its self-igniting temperature.
